Heritage Animal Hospital offers a comprehensive suite of veterinary services designed to address the full spectrum of a pet's health needs, focusing on proactive and personalized care for dogs and cats.
- Pet Wellness Programs: Progressive preventative health screenings tailored to each pet's specific life stage, breed, age, and environmental factors. This includes comprehensive annual physical exams and age-appropriate ancillary diagnostics.
- Vaccinations: Customized vaccination protocols to protect against various diseases, including lifestyle-dependent vaccines.
- Diagnostics: Utilizing an in-house laboratory for rapid results on blood work, urinalysis, and other diagnostic tests. They also offer digital X-rays and ultrasound for advanced imaging, including PennHip X-rays for orthopedic screening.
- Surgical Procedures: A range of surgical services from routine spays and neuters to more complex soft tissue surgeries, performed with careful monitoring.
- Pet Dental Care: Comprehensive dental cleanings, extractions, and preventative dental programs to ensure optimal oral health.
- Pain Management: Effective strategies for managing both acute and chronic pain, utilizing various therapeutic approaches.
- Preventative Medicine: Recommendations for heartworm, flea, and tick preventatives, as well as intestinal parasite control measures.
- Alternative Therapies: Offering innovative treatments such as laser therapy for wound care, pain management, and chronic conditions, and skilled veterinary chiropractic services for neurological or biomechanical issues.
- End-of-Life Decisions and Euthanasia: Providing compassionate consultations, palliative/hospice care options, and dignified euthanasia services, including options for cremation and keepsakes like paw prints in clay.
- Nutritional Counseling: Guidance on diet, weight management, and husbandry to maintain overall pet health.
- Microchipping: Services to microchip pets for permanent identification and increased chances of reunion if lost.
- Emergency Services: While primarily a general practice, they are able to handle urgent cases during business hours and provide referrals to emergency hospitals for after-hours care.

Dec 26, 2023 · Jim MillerSubject: Disappointing Experience with Veterinary CareDear Heritage Veterinary HospitalI wanted to share my recent experience with your practice, as it has left me quite disappointed. My family and I relocated to the area and chose your practice for our dog’s care, hoping to find a reliable provider. However, after a recent interaction, I regret not continuing the 25-minute drive to our previous veterinary office.We visited in October for a wellness exam and to establish care for my dog, who requires regular allergy injections every 1 to 4 months. In my previous experience with other veterinary practices, these subsequent injections have always been administered by a veterinary technician after the initial vet visit.Recently, I called to schedule an injection appointment, 4 months after our initial visit. The receptionist, while polite, informed me that the appointment would need to be with a veterinarian, which would make it more expensive. I asked if I could speak with the vet to discuss this, given that we had been seen just a few months prior and that the injection is part of an ongoing treatment for my dog’s chronic allergy issues. She mentioned she would make a note and have the vet contact me, though likely not the same day.Later that day, I received another call from what appeared to be an administrative staff member, reiterating that the visit would require a vet. When I inquired further, I was told that because my dog had only been seen once, the vet needed to reassess him before transitioning to technician-administered injections. I expressed my disagreement, explaining that the number of visits should not dictate the need for a vet visit but should be based on the pet’s individual needs and health status. I was then told that the vet needed to reassess my dog’s heart, lungs, and skin, which I felt was unnecessary, as no new health concerns had arisen since our last visit, and the only issue was his ongoing allergy symptoms.To my surprise, after I pushed back, the staff member became dismissive and rude, stating that the vet would likely not offer any new perspective but could call me if I wished. This comment felt particularly unprofessional and lacked the compassion I expected from a veterinary practice.As of today, five days after my request to speak with the vet, I have still not received a follow-up. This delay and lack of communication make me feel that my concerns are neither prioritized nor valued. It is particularly disappointing given that I was simply seeking clarification and a reasonable solution for an ongoing treatment, rather than unnecessary, costly visits.As a military family that has moved frequently, we’ve had many interactions with veterinary practices across the U.S., and I have never felt so dismissed by a request to communicate with a veterinarian. I believe that veterinary care, like all healthcare, should be tailored to each pet's specific needs, rather than following a rigid protocol.While I typically avoid leaving negative reviews, I felt compelled to share this experience in the hopes that others in similar situations may consider other options in the area. My expectations for professionalism, communication, client autonomy and compassion were not met, and I hope that this feedback can help improve your practice’s approach to client care.
